What Virginia requires
Virginia generally requires coverage when a business regularly has more than two employees — and contractors should count subcontractor workers toward the threshold. Claims run through the Workers’ Compensation Commission with a 30-day notice rule and a hard two-year filing bar.

Chesapeake workers’ comp rates
Virginia’s loss costs fell 7.7% effective April 1, 2026 — the sixth consecutive annual decrease. Our Virginia rates guide explains how to capture the trend.
Chesapeake rates on Virginia’s statewide loss costs, six years into decreases. For its trades and services, correct splits (field vs. clerical, maintenance vs. installation) are the local premium lever.

Chesapeake workers’ comp FAQs
Do Chesapeake contractors need to count subs toward Virginia’s threshold?
Yes — Virginia counts subcontractor workers when determining whether coverage is required, a rule that surprises many Hampton Roads GCs. We confirm your status at quote.
What do Chesapeake landscapers pay?
Green-industry classes rate mid-to-upper table, with the maintenance/installation/tree-work splits driving the real number — Virginia’s falling loss costs help every year you re-shop.
Can you insure a business working across Hampton Roads cities?
Yes — one Virginia policy covers work throughout the state; multi-state adds (NC especially) are routine for border-crossing crews.
